Output 43712107ec1d3b19dba223d61de79d48375d01c5fcc4ae3e744d2a057416715f:1

value
61766885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ffa9c566272a06ee41dbc74daaf97ff64307b04c OP_EQUAL
address
MXCyvFQ8n5dqKUJu9x6RcxTkpiW12BoAbu
transaction
43712107ec1d3b19dba223d61de79d48375d01c5fcc4ae3e744d2a057416715f
spent
true